For anyone not familiar, SotDL is in most respects a traditional fantasy game, but with a decidedly dark and twisted spin. It is any given D&D world, gone terribly, terribly wrong. Madness, corruption and brutal, savage violence are commonplace. New players are welcome and no experience with the game system or setting is required.
